Cult favourite Daniel Kitson previews new material for his first stand-up show since 2009. 

Having just completed a New York run of his latest story-based show, It's Always Right Now, Until It's Later, the comedian and monologist will be writing and previewing a new hour of stand-up material in London over the next two months, before taking it to Australia and Edinburgh.

Titled Where Once Was Wonder, Kitson said the show is "likely to be about change and impossibility and defiance and inevitability all topped off with lashings of arrogance and self doubt".
